Transaction 40dd969dd02671ff1a96a52c792897c9398b388d2b2e18b038fec53a93769519
1 Input
1 Output
-
40dd969dd02671ff1a96a52c792897c9398b388d2b2e18b038fec53a93769519:0
- value
- 23996160
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 eeb5cd30d155ce25ecd7d38f8906d82d6f449923 OP_EQUAL
- address
- 3PTCXzRaNhUFoMGDGRpiDZ9ko8bNhyqmYV